SANTA ANA, Calif. -(Ammoland.com)- The National Rifle League (NRL), a 501c3 non-profit organization dedicated to the growth and education of precision rifle shooting through a range of outdoors-related public interest activities, announced today that they will be producing a National .22 Rimfire Precision league titled the NRL 22.

The NRL 22 is a division of the National Rifle League created to provide a way for shooters that are looking to get into the sport of precision rifle shooting an opportunity to do so without having to invest a lot of money in gear and travel.

The goal of the NRL 22 is to make Tactical Rifle shooting more available to every community. The league will be designed so that any facility with a 100-yard range can participate in local competitions to qualify for a regional match, and then move on to the National Championship.
